About this calculator
This calculator finds hydrostatic pressure at a given depth using P = P₀ + ρgh, where P₀ is the pressure at the surface (usually atmospheric), ρ is the fluid's density, g is gravitational acceleration, and h is depth. Pressure increases linearly with depth because of the growing weight of fluid above.
Divers and diving instructors use it to understand pressure changes underwater, engineers use it to design tanks, dams, and submersible equipment, and physics students use it for fluid mechanics coursework. Enter the fluid density and depth to get the pressure at that point instantly.
